This coffee comes from Banko Chelchele, in the Gedeb woreda of the Gedeo Zone, within Ethiopia's Southern Nations, Nationalities, and Peoples' Region (SNNPR). This region is renowned for its high-quality coffee production, and Chelchele specifically is known for producing exceptional coffee beans that are highly sought after in the global market.

The process of harvesting coffee in Chelchele involves meticulous care and attention to detail.  Ripe, red cherries are handpicked and sorted to remove any debris or under and overripe fruit. For this natural process, the whole cherry is dried in the sun rather than having the skin and pulp removed first. Drying takes two to four weeks, with the cherries turned regularly to ensure even drying. Once dried to the desired moisture level, the cherries rest in a cool space for a few weeks before hulling and milling remove the dried skin, pulp, and parchment to reveal the green coffee.

This anaerobic natural process is known for imparting unique fruity and complex flavours to the coffee beans, and it's widely considered one of the most traditional and authentic methods of coffee processing in Ethiopia.

Recommendation: 


Rest time: 2-3 weeks
Espresso: 1:2.4 - 91c, 26-30s 
Filter: 1:15.5-16.5, 90c
